L.A. previews February 16-22: Justo
Fri. Feb. 16 -- Saxist Justo Almario always has first-rate bandmates who dig his big tone, flexible swing and love of every kind of jazz. At the World Stage, 4321 Degnan Blvd., Leimert Park 90008; 8pm (two sets); $20; http://www.theworldstage.org./

Rest in peace my brother Ndugu Chancler I was telling him how much I enjoy his playing. Photo courtesy of Todd M. Simon
Lamenting deep in my heart the passing of the great musician Ndugu Chancler, great friend and a brother and a blessing to me. We work together for over twenty years with The Jazz Classics Quartet featuring Patrice Rushen and Ndugu Chancler. Rest in peace my dear brother, thank you for sharing your musicianship with me and the world; you will be in my heart forever.
